Transaction 94757013913c788bdc427836c6170b8f0c088233a8e4fdcc2bed20583d2c2be9
1 Input
1 Output
-
94757013913c788bdc427836c6170b8f0c088233a8e4fdcc2bed20583d2c2be9:0
- value
- 37352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ddc82f0b035f0f36181bdbcd409b489e2a53fcdd OP_EQUAL
- address
- 3Muh4x3g8LL6AjiQrfKnXJbrLcFoM8h18Y